The answer is that the text, even though it links the twoevents together, that is, a) the manifestation of the nakedness and b)‘sewing together leaves of the garden’, uses the conjunction wa- (and),not in order to indicate cause and effect (because of their nakednessthey collected leaves) but rather to narrate the sequence of events(first nakedness, then the collection of leaves). Why can it not be acausative wa-? Because we are told, in another verse, that Allah hasassured Adam and his wife that they will not ‘go hungry or naked,suffer thirst or the sun’s heat’:…their shame became manifest to them, and [wa-] they began to sewtogether the leaves of the garden over their bodies… ( Al-A#r§f7:20–22)“There is therein (enough provision) for you not to go hungry or to gonaked, * nor to suffer from thirst, nor from the sun’s heat.” (•§-H§"20:118–19)We understand that Allah placed Adam and his wife in His Gardenwhere both cannot go hungry (fruits of the earth are plenty), orthirsty (water everywhere), or be harmed by the sun’s heat (noshadow required). Hence, Allah does not request saturation (whichis permanent), nor does He want them to get dressed (nakedness isnormal). Allah does not ask them to still their thirst (it is permanentlystilled), nor does He want them to seek shelter in the shade (no heatcan harm them). Allah only asks them not to come near the tree.But Allah’s creation consists of fallible human beings who are weakand forgetful, and indeed Adam ended up as a sinner because of hisforgetfulness:We also commanded Adam before you, but he forgot and We foundhim lacking in constancy. (•§-H§"20:115, AH)After Adam disobeyed his Lord and went astray, he was expelled toan open land where hunger and thirst reigned. He discovered theneed to dress against the cold and to seek the cooling shade againstthe sun. They suddenly faced the need to work which was particularlypainful for women because in matriarchal societies womenworked more and harder than men. And yet, the reason why Adamand his wife ‘began to sew together the leaves of the garden overtheir bodies’ was not because of the cold but because of a childishimpulse to hide their wrongdoings as soon as they realised the gravityof their sin.
